Heim > Web-Frontend > CSS-Tutorial > Warum werden meine Hintergrundbilder in Safari nicht richtig angezeigt?

Warum werden meine Hintergrundbilder in Safari nicht richtig angezeigt?

Barbara Streisand
Freigeben: 2025-01-03 00:56:39
Original
811 Leute haben es durchsucht

Why Are My Background Images Not Displaying Properly in Safari?

Problem bei der Darstellung von Safari-Hintergrundbildern

Safari-Benutzer können in bestimmten Situationen auf Schwierigkeiten beim Anzeigen von Hintergrundbildern stoßen, obwohl sie in anderen Browsern korrekt angezeigt werden. Eine häufige Ursache für dieses Problem ist das Format und die Optimierung des Bildes selbst.

Progressive JPEG-Problem

Safari hat ein spezielles Problem mit progressiven JPEG-Bildern. Bei der progressiven Kodierung werden Bilddaten schrittweise geladen, was zunächst zu einem unscharfen Erscheinungsbild führt. Während diese Technik die wahrgenommene Leistung beim Laden verbessern kann, stößt Safari auf Schwierigkeiten, wenn progressive JPEGs als Hintergrundbilder verwendet werden.

Kriterien, die sich auf die Safari-Bildwiedergabe auswirken

Mehrere Faktoren können dazu beitragen dieses Problem:

  • Progressive JPEG-Kodierung
  • Bild wird als Hintergrund verwendet (Element oder seitenweit)
  • Große Bildgröße (normalerweise in Tausenden von Pixeln)
  • Potenzielle zusätzliche Faktoren

Lösung

Um dieses Problem zu lösen, ziehen Sie die folgenden Lösungen in Betracht:

  • Konvertieren in Nicht progressives JPEG: Speichern Sie das Bild erneut mit einem Bildbearbeitungsprogramm, um die progressive Kodierung zu entfernen.
  • Verwenden Sie ein alternatives Format: Entscheiden Sie sich für ein anderes Bildformat wie GIF oder PNG , die weniger anfällig für dieses Problem sind.

Durch die Behebung dieser Faktoren können Sie sicherstellen, dass Hintergrundbilder in Safari korrekt angezeigt werden und so für ein einheitliches Benutzererlebnis sorgen verschiedene Browser.

Das obige ist der detaillierte Inhalt vonWarum werden meine Hintergrundbilder in Safari nicht richtig angezeigt?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age